[0002] The production workshop is the infrastructure of the enterprise. Some modern workshops deal with the ground, some use epoxy resin paint, some use plastic floors, and some lay anti-static floors. These floor materials will volatilize formaldehyde, especially the ground floor. The material is relatively new, some new equipment is installed in the workshop, and the doors and windows are closed to prevent dust. At this time, the harm of formaldehyde in the workshop to the human body cannot be ignored. Although some workshops are equipped with ventilation equipment or fresh air systems, fresh air outside After the dust is filtered, it is connected to the workshop, but the existing ventilation equipment or fresh air system is limited by the location and number of the air outlets. On the other side, the wind force is small, the air volume is small, and the ventilation effect in the workshop is not uniform enough, so there are formaldehyde residues in some areas of the production workshop. There are currently many methods for how to detect formaldehyde residues in the workshop from all directions and from multiple angles. Some adopt portable mobile type, some adopt multi-point sensor sampling type, and some adopt hanging rail mobile trolley type
[0003] These technologies have their own characteristics and can detect formaldehyde residues to a certain extent, but portable manual equipment is labor-intensive, multi-point sensors need to use several sensors, the auxiliary circuits are complex, and the cost is high. The mechanical device structure of the hanging rail mobile trolley Complicated, difficult to implement, and expensive

Abstract

The invention provides a production workshop air quality data collecting and processing system; an inner barrel, blades and a rotating opening are driven by a motor to rotate in an outer barrel; when the rotating opening in the inner barrel rotates around a main shaft, and the rotating opening is aligned with thin pipe openings in gas inlet pipelines in turn; sampled gas flow sequentially passes through one of eight gas sampling ports, one horn mouth of the eight gas inlet pipelines, one thin pipe opening of the eight gas inlet pipelines, the rotating port, the blades, an interlayer, a collecting pipe, a transition pipe and a rainproof cover, and then is discharged out of a workshop. The air quality at different positions in the workshop can be collected through the method that gas enters the workshop by turns through the eight gas inlet pipelines, and the using amount of sensors of the system is small; although the system is fixed, the system has the movable or multi-point sampling type measurement effect, the measurement area range is comprehensive, and centralized monitoring and centralized management of multiple workshops can be achieved.
